The Cost of Fencing An Overview of Barbed Wire Prices
When it comes to securing land and property, barbed wire fencing is one of the most cost-effective and widely used solutions. Known for its durability and effectiveness in deterring intruders and livestock, barbed wire has been a popular choice in agricultural, residential, and industrial settings. However, the price of barbed wire can vary significantly based on various factors that potential buyers need to consider.

One of the primary factors influencing barbed wire pricing is the gauge of the wire. The gauge refers to the thickness of the wire, with lower gauge numbers indicating thicker wire. Thicker wire tends to be stronger and more resistant to bending or breaking, making it an ideal choice for high-traffic or rough environments. However, as the gauge decreases (thickness increases), the price per foot may rise accordingly.
Another consideration is the geographical location and market demand. Prices might vary from region to region based on local availability and demand for fencing materials. In areas where agriculture is predominant, such as rural communities, there might be a steady demand for barbed wire, keeping prices relatively stable. Conversely, urban areas may see fluctuating prices based on supply chain logistics and varying demand.
In addition to the cost of the wire itself, buyers should also account for installation expenses. If planning to install the fence themselves, they will need to purchase additional materials, such as fence posts, insulators, and staples, which can add to the overall cost. Alternatively, hiring professionals for installation can significantly increase the budget but may be worth the investment for those lacking the necessary skills or equipment.
In conclusion, the cost of barbed wire fencing is influenced by factors such as wire gauge, material quality, geographical location, and installation expenses. When budgeting for a fencing project, it is advisable to conduct thorough research and compare prices from multiple suppliers to ensure a good deal.
